How to...
- How to thaw king crab legs safely? Defrost them in the refrigerator overnight.
- How to cook perfect king crab legs? Steam them for 10-12 minutes until the meat is opaque.
- How to crack king crab legs easily? Use a crab cracker or a nutcracker.
- How to store leftover king crab legs? Store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2 days.
- How to reheat king crab legs? Reheat them in the oven or microwave until warmed through.
